我试图解开一些变量,然后在传递给def时将它们连接起来,这就是我正在尝试的,但它出错了。
class Try
def test
@name = "bob"
@password = "password"
self.send(@name,@password)
end
def send(*data)
print data #prints orginal data
print ":".join(data) #errors
end
end
我是不是做错了什么?
如何获得单个单词标记的词干形式?这是我的密码。它适用于某些词,但不适用于另一些词。
let text = "people" // works
// let text = "geese" // doesn't work
let tagger = NLTagger(tagSchemes: [.lemma])
tagger.string = text
let (tag, range) = tagger.tag(at: text.startIndex, unit: .word, scheme: .lemma)
let stemForm = tag?.rawVal
我想用拼音从0.0001数到1,步数是0.0001。我写了这段代码,但它进入了一个无限循环。这就是为什么解释器做了一个错误的求和。
x = 0.0001
while x != 1.0
puts x
x = x + 0.0001
end
下面是它给出的前10个值:
0.0001
0.0002
0.00030000000000000003
0.0004
0.0005
0.0006000000000000001
0.0007000000000000001
0.0008000000000000001
0.0009000000000000002
0.0010000000000000002
它应该
背景
我正在使用HTTParty来解析XML响应。不幸的是,当散列响应只有一个条目(?)时,产生的散列是不可索引的。我已经确认,对于单项和多项(?),生成的XML语法是相同的。我还确认了当总是有多个条目(?)时,我的代码可以工作。在散列中。
问题
我如何适应单个散列条目的情况和/或有没有更容易的方法来完成我想要做的事情?
代码
require 'httparty'
class Rest
include HTTParty
format :xml
end
def test_redeye
# rooms and devices
roo
我正在使用Ruby编写一个编解码器来压缩图像。现在我正在使用一个硬编码的图像文件,但我想从用户那里检索一个图像文件。
收集此信息的正确语法是什么?
这是我目前所拥有的:
# Set the path for the input image
path = "#{File.dirname(__FILE__)}/../../Images/my_image.png"
image = ImageList.new(path)
然后我使用RMagick操作图像,但这是不相关的。允许用户从控制台中的当前路径向我提供图像的正确方法是什么?
谢谢!
<%= f.text_area :comment, placeholder: "Comment on your track or" + \n + "share your favorite lyrics" %>
我怎样才能让占位符像这样换行呢?
解决方案只是添加空格,这样下一行就会换行:
placeholder: "Comment on your track or share your favorite lyrics" %>
相当难看,但最简单
我逐行浏览文件,并在每一行中查找单词" BIOS“,因为包含单词BIOS的每一行都有一个我需要的版本号。在我看到行中包含单词"BIOS“之后,我想取整行,并将其拆分为一个数组。下面是我的代码:
File.open(file).each do |line|
if line.includes? 'BIOS'
array = line.split(" ")
end
end
我遇到的问题是我一直收到一个错误,说“包含?”是一个未定义的方法。有没有更好的方法来解析这个文件的每一行,以获得特定的字符串?
我有代码:
def crop_word (film_title)
size = film_title.size
film_title[0...size-2] if size > 4
end
film = "Electrocity"
p crop_word film
如果我想修改object film,我必须怎么做?(如何创建crop_word方法作为赋值方法?)
p crop_word film #=> "Electroci"
p crop_word film #=> "Electro"
p crop_word fil
我正在努力实现英语单词到音素单词的翻译,为CMUSphinx创建一个语言模型。现在我正在使用以下工具来实现单词翻译
例如,如果我给出一个文本文件作为输入,输入的单词如下所示
NAMASTE N AH M EY S T
但是我想用Java动态地做这件事。有没有任何应用程序接口或库可以实现这一点,我不想重新发明wheel.Or,一些其他编程语言,它有我可以使用的库。